Chelsea Agrees £40M Deal for Manchester United Winger Garnacho

News summary

Alejandro Garnacho has completed a £40 million transfer from Manchester United to Chelsea, signing a seven-year contract with the Blues. The 21-year-old winger's move ends an eight-month pursuit by Chelsea, who had initially failed to secure him in January. Garnacho fell out of favor at United under manager Ruben Amorim, who excluded him from key matches including the Europa League final, and informed him he was free to find a new club. Chelsea's offer eclipses the previous record for an academy graduate sale by United, and the deal includes a 10 percent sell-on clause. Although Garnacho cannot wear his preferred numbers due to them being taken, he is expected to compete for a left-wing spot and will join several new signings at Stamford Bridge. The opportunity to play Champions League football and the chance to reignite his career were key factors influencing his decision to leave United for Chelsea.
